    Choosing the Right Motor Grader for Indian Infrastructure Projects

    desi-machines-choosing-the best-motor-grader-for-infrastructure-projects
    • By Sanjiv Yadav

    • Apr 21, 2025

    • ( 0 )

    Choosing the right motor grader is essential when building strong roads, highways, and other key infrastructure in India. These machines are experts in surface finishing, slope grading, and road construction.

    In India, many brands manufacture motor graders, and multiple models are found from each brand. So selecting the right motor grader for your project is a tough job. In this blog, you will learn the factors to decide the right motor grader, along with popular models.

    What is a Motor Grader?

    A motor grader is a construction machine that is used to create flat surfaces during grading operations. A long blade is installed for leveling, shaping the ground, cutting ditches, and snow removal in colder regions.

    In India, there are varied terrain comprising of unique challenges, and road construction vary from one place to another. For every condition, there are different motor grader. Hence, motor graders are important pieces of equipment in making timely and cost-effective completion of projects.

    Why Choosing the Right Motor Grader Matters 

    Selecting a motor grader that is tailored to the task assures optimal performance, economical operation, and accomplishment of the project. Here are reasons why your choice matters:

    • Ensures Accuracy: Selecting the right motor grader provides accurate grading results, particularly in road grading, ditching, or site leveling. This guarantees a smoother surface, allowing for better drainage and high quality road for long-lasting.
    • Reduces Cost: The right grader has a fuel-efficient engine, strong components, and high-tech performance specifications that reduce fuel consumption, repair costs, and overall operating costs..
    • Reduces Downtime and Enhances Performance: A reliable motor grader is a very much crucial for your project. It performs consistently without frequent breakdowns, hence incurs minimum downtime, allowing it to maintain the project timeline.
    • Improves Productivity and Fuel Efficiency: The technological features such as automatic controls and adjustable blade angles, and user-friendly operator controls, modern graders allow operators to complete tasks faster while reducing fuel consumption.
    • Ensures Appropriateness to Terrain and Jobsite Conditions: Choosing the right motor grader designed for specific terrain ensures fast movement, traction, and stability, whether the site of work is hilly terrain, rural paved roads, or urban construction areas.
    • Key Factors to Consider While Choosing the Right Motor Grader

    The right motor grader affects the efficiency, costs, and timeline of the project. The motor grader can be used for village roads or expressways. The following elaborate guidelines will assist you in choosing the right motor grader, adhering to your working criteria:

    1. Understand Your Project Needs

    The project should be clearly defined. It is very important to ascertain the project type or the terrain it will work on. Rural terrain will have a different motor grader compared to hilly or mining sites.

    Before selecting a motor grader, ask:

    • Are you working on national highways or rural roads?
    • Is the project large-scale or compact?
    • Will you work in hilly terrain or flat land?

    Match the grader’s specs with the application.

    2. Engine Power & Performance

    Engine power means how productively the grader can cut, move, and finish material.

    Project Type Ideal Engine Power
    Rural Roads 120 – 140 HP
    State Highways 150 – 180 HP
    Expressways / Mining 180+ HP

    Top Motor Grader in India: 

    • Mahindra RoadMaster G75 Smart (74 HP) – Best for rural and PMGSY road projects.
    • CASE 845B (173 HP) – Mid-power grader with solid performance in highways.
    • CAT 120 GC (145 HP) – A well-balanced performer, fit for both urban and rural needs.

    3. Blade Width & Grading Reach

    The grader’s blade directly affects the quantity of material moved with one pass.

    • Blade width range: 2.5 to 4.3 m.
    • Look for adjustable blades with multi-angle positioning.
    • Greater reach means fewer passes, saving time and fuel.

    4. Hydraulics & Controls of the motor grader

    Modern motor graders come with advanced hydraulics and joystick controls.

    • Choose graders with load-sensing hydraulics.
    • Electro-hydraulic controls improve precision.
    • Intuitive joystick layouts reduce operator fatigue, and modern operators’ cabin enhances operators’ comfort.

    5. Fuel Efficiency & Emission Compliance

    In Indian conditions, fuel efficiency is critical.

    • Always go for engines with BS-IV compliance or newer.
    • Choose machines with Eco-mode or intelligent power modes.
    • Real-time fuel tracking is important and should be checked while buying.

    6. Operator Comfort & Cabin Features

    Motor Grader should be designed ergonomically, which enhances operators’ comfort during long working hours.

    • Look for spacious, air-conditioned cabins for long hours of work.
    • Adjustable seats and armrests help reduce fatigue for the operator.
    • Clear visibility, noise insulation, and rearview cameras improve safety.

    7. Brand Reputation & Service Network

    After-sales support is very crucial for a right motor grader as it helps reduce breakdowns and downtime.
    Some top brands in India:

    Brand  Notable Models Service Strength
    Mahindra Construction Equipment RoadMaster G75, RoadMaster G9075 Good in rural & tier 2 cities.
    Caterpillar 120 GC, 140 GC Global reputation, reliable service.
    CASE 845B, 865B Strong in urban and infrastructure hubs.
    Komatsu GD535-6, GD955-7 Reliable, but the service can be city-centric.
    BEML BG405A, BG605A Reliable and has a wide service network

    8. Initial Investment vs. Long-Term ROI 

    • Purchase of the right motor grader: Never just go for the lowest; always evaluate all features and quality.
    • Warranty & AMC: Longer warranty and comprehensive AMC on the machines give peace of mind.
    • Maintenance Interval: Machines with longer maintenance intervals lead to less downtime and lower costs. Shorter intervals would often lead to more downtime and greater expenditures.
    • Fuel Consumption: Go for graders that are fuel-efficient and save your operating costs in the long run.
    • Resale Value: Brands recognized by all, with their high and consistent performance, will be able to demand a higher resale value.
    • Smart Investment: A slight increase in the initial investment offers the promise of a better performance factor lower maintenance and better ROI over 5-7 years.

    9. Safety Features while choosing the right motor grader

    • ROPS/FOPS Certified Cabins: The operator’s safety is very important from rollovers and falling objects, especially in rough and challenging terrain.
    • Emergency Stop Switches: Allow quick machine shutdown in case of unexpected hazards or malfunctions.
    • Anti-Slip Steps & Safety Lockouts: Ensure safe entry and exit from the cabin while preventing accidental operations.
    • Advanced Braking Systems: The modern braking systems offer better control, especially on slopes or during sudden stops, enhancing site safety.

    The above features are of utmost importance as these features reduce the risk of accidents, improve operator confidence, and ensure site safety regulations.

    10. Availability of Attachments

    Modern projects demand versatility with attachments used in the motor grader.

    • Look for the right motor graders compatible with rippers, scarifiers, and snowplows.
    • Attachments should be easy to mount and replace.
    • Flexible use enhances better ROI.

    Indian Motor Grader Market is Changing (2025)

    • Increasing Demand of Low Power Graders: There are schemes like PMGSY which are further assisting in the growth in demand of the 90-130 HP graders that are best suited and cost-effective for small road projects, thus affecting the rural infrastructure development.
    • Efficiency in Fuel: Fuel prices keep fluctuating, which are making emit the requirement of electronically controlled engines, fuel efficient, and power management.
    • Emission Norms Conformity: New BSIV engines are installed in all newly developed machines of construction and the entire industry is moving towards sustainability.
    • Conformance to Telemetry and IoT: The advanced features in this particular field include telematics and GPS, which have been installed for real-time monitoring, preventive maintenance, and remote diagnostics.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    Q.1. Which is the most popular motor grader brand in India?

    Ans. Caterpillar is the most favourite and popular motor grader and currently holds about 40% of the market share.

    Q.2. What is unique about Mahindra’s motor graders?

    Ans. The Mahindra RoadMaster series is a popular model and is the right motor grader for small and medium contractors for its cost-efficiency feature.

    Q.3. Which is better for rural or small road projects?

    Ans. Mahindra is usually better for small-scale roadwork due to its affordability and ease of use. Models like the RoadMaster G75 Smart are built for rural and semi-urban road construction.​

    Q.4. Which is better for government projects?

    Ans. BEML (Bharat Earth Movers Limited) is often preferred for government projects. As a public sector undertaking, BEML manufactures a variety of heavy equipment suited for public infrastructure development.

    Q.5. Which motor grader brand is best for cost-effectiveness?

    Ans. Mahindra offers some of the most cost-effective motor graders in India. Their RoadMaster series provides fuel efficiency and low operating costs, making them ideal for budget-conscious projects.​

    Q.6. Which motor grader is best for large infrastructure projects?

    Ans. Caterpillar motor graders are best suited for large infrastructure projects. Their machines offer advanced technology, durability, and performance required for extensive construction work.

    Q.7. What are the uses of Motor Grader?

    Ans. A motor grader is a heavy construction machine whose primary purpose is grading and leveling surfaces. It is widely used in road construction, mining, and other land development activities to grade the surface before laying asphalt and concrete.

    Q.8. How Does a Motor Grader Work?

    Ans. A motor grader is graded by a long blade between the front and the rear axles. The blade is adjusted at different angles and pitches, making it possible to cut, spread, and level materials like soil, gravel, and aggregates. Some models also have rippers and scarifiers to break up very tough surfaces.

    Q.9. How Much Does A Motor Grader Cost In India?

    Ans. Motor graders cost between ₹35 lacs and ₹1.2 crores in India, depending on brand and model, power, and attachments. The big names in this industry include Caterpillar, CASE, Komatsu, Mahindra, and LiuGong.

    Q.10. What is the difference between a Motor Grader and a Bulldozer?

    Ans. A motor grader grades and moves earth, but the bulldozer has a very large front blade as a dirt pusher to push earth or debris. A grader is used for fine grading and leveling by means of a long, adjustable blade.
